The microprocessor and GPU market in Singapore is a dynamic sector that caters to various applications, from personal computing to data centers and edge devices. The demand for more powerful and energy-efficient processors and graphics processing units continues to drive this market. It is influenced by trends in artificial intelligence, gaming, and cloud computing.
The Singapore microprocessor and GPU market is primarily driven by the continuous demand for high-performance computing solutions. Microprocessors and GPUs are vital components in various devices, from personal computers to gaming consoles and AI accelerators. The market`s growth is influenced by the need for powerful and energy-efficient processors to support advanced computing applications.
The microprocessor and GPU market in Singapore grapples with challenges associated with performance, power consumption, and market saturation. Meeting the ever-increasing demand for higher computational performance while managing power consumption is an ongoing engineering challenge. As the market becomes saturated, differentiation and innovation become critical for companies to remain competitive. Moreover, ensuring that microprocessors and GPUs are compatible with a wide range of software applications and platforms presents a continuous challenge.
The COVID-19 pandemic significantly affected the Singapore microprocessor and GPU market. Supply chain disruptions and manufacturing delays posed challenges, impacting the market`s operations. However, the increased demand for microprocessors and GPUs in remote work, gaming, and digital content creation provided opportunities for the market. Companies in Singapore had to adjust to meet this growing demand, underscoring the importance of adaptability and resilience in addressing market fluctuations. The pandemic highlighted the central role of microprocessors and GPUs in enabling digital technology and remote work.
In the Singapore Microprocessor and GPU market, key players include companies such as Intel Corporation, Advanced Micro Devices Inc., and NVIDIA Corporation. Microprocessors and graphics processing units (GPUs) are core components in computers, mobile devices, and data centers. These companies have been driving innovation in microprocessor and GPU technology, offering high-performance solutions for various applications. The market`s growth is closely tied to the demand for faster and more efficient computing, particularly in gaming, AI, and data processing.
